How Sussex Inlet is zoned
Across its 36.8 km², Sussex Inlet is highly constrained by planning overlays. Very little of the suburb carries a mapped flood overlay, and 91% is flagged bushfire-prone. There are 4 heritage-listed sites on record, and the dominant land-use zone is Rural Landscape. The median lot measures about 691 m² across 2,809 parcels. These figures are suburb-wide - the overlays that actually apply to a given lot can differ block to block, which is what a property-level check tells you.

Is Sussex Inlet flood-prone?
Very little of Sussex Inlet carries a mapped flood overlay. Flood overlays vary block to block, so whether a particular lot is affected needs a property-level check.
Is Sussex Inlet bushfire-prone?
Yes - around 91% of Sussex Inlet is mapped as bushfire-prone, compared with a Shoalhaven average of 90%. A bushfire-prone designation can trigger additional building requirements, so check the specific address.
What is the zoning in Sussex Inlet?
The dominant planning zone in Sussex Inlet is Rural Landscape, though the suburb also includes Environmental Conservation and Large Lot Residential. Zoning sets what you can build and do on a site, and can differ lot by lot.
Does Sussex Inlet have heritage-listed places?
Sussex Inlet has 4 heritage-listed places on record. Heritage listing affects what you can alter or demolish, so confirm whether a specific property is listed or near a heritage place.
What is the typical lot size in Sussex Inlet?
Across 2,809 surveyed parcels in Sussex Inlet, the median lot size is about 691 m². There are also 5 registered easements mapped in the suburb - an easement can restrict where you can build, so always check the title and overlays for the specific lot.
Does Sussex Inlet have a train station?
There is no train station inside Sussex Inlet itself. The suburb is served by 210 bus stops.
